#59 USING NATURAL CYCLES TO BUILD MASS TOP-SOIL W/WILL HARRIS OF WHITE OAK PASTURES
Herb your enthusiasm
01/11/24 • 57 min
Episode #59 Herb your enthusiasm.
Today's guest is ex-JRE guest; Will Harris of Bluffton, Georgia in the states..
Will is a 4th generation cattle farmer and current owner of white oak pastures, which has been owned by his family since 1866.
Across it's long history, white oak pastures has gone through many iterations.
Upon inheriting his farm as a young man, will operated the farm in alignment with an industrial model of farming, utilising tonnes of Petro-chemical fertiliser, heavy chemical spray regimes to control weeds and "problem organisms" as well as intensive feed-lot operations and heavy anti-biotic regimens for his livestock.
As you'll hear in the podcast, a single brief but powerful moment in time one afternoon, lead him to reconsider the path he was going down with respect to the "kill and control" style of farming he had become accustomed to on the farm.
following this personal realisation- at great financial expense, will began to transition away from a typical industrial model of farming and towards am ecological/regenerative model, and one that honoured and respected life in all its forms and the relationships between them.
20 years later and white oak pastures is now a world leader in profitable, sustainable farming and one of the few sustainable regenerative farms in his state.
the multiple 10's of inches of rich, dark top soil that white oaks has created since moving to a regenerative model is something to behold and instead of spending his time figuring out how to kill organisms, will now thinks about the best ways to keep things alive.

#69 NO-HASSLE BEE-KEEPING AND LABOUR-FREE HONEY IN THE SUBURBS WITH CEDAR ANDERSON OF FLOWHIVE
Herb your enthusiasm
04/28/24 • 46 min
This podcast episode, Sammy will be featuring Australian Entrepeneur; Cedar Anderson, the co-inventor of the FlowHive.
Flowhive is an innovative new bee-hive system that has revolutionised home-bee keeping.
From the outside, Flow Hives look like a regular commercial beehive, that is, the traditional "wooden box" containing multiple frames which support the bees as they create their honeycomb.
In these traditional beehives, when the honey is ready for harvest. the frames are taken out and spun in a centrifuge system to extract honey.
Now, enter FLOW Hives.
Flow hives feature an ingenious system of pre-inserted, pre-molded frames made up of hundreds of individual hexagonal cells which mimic a natural honeycomb structure.
Once the bees are introduced, they then discover these cells, fill them with honey.
When all the cells are filled, the owner of the FlowHive can then turn a special key to fracture each of the cells to releasing all the honey at once.
The honey then slowly flows out of a tap and into glass collection jars. After collection the special key it turned again, re-setting the molds to their original position, to be filled with honey once again.
This Ingenious and elegant re-imagining of a beehive eliminates the otherwise messy, time-consuming and sometimes dangerous process of honey extraction.
With a FlowHive, there is next to no need to disturb, then pacify your bees and no need to use a centrifuge before you can enjoy the fruits of your bees' labour.
